Mitch Rose is a senior lecturer in the Department of Geography and Earth Sciences and a reader in the Graduate School at Aberystwyth University.

“If culture as an analytical concept has fallen out of fashion, how then to address the increasing salience of culture wars and identity politics? Mitch Rose brilliantly poses this problem and urges by way of solution that culture be theorized in terms not of essential differences but rather of existential claims, cares and concerns. This book challenges us to consider how dreams and desires—elusive though they must be—enable people to make distinct worlds and thereby manage universal struggles.”
